Abstract : IoT is converting the agriculture sector by permitting peasants to gather and analyze data in real time to improve efficiency, productivity, and profitability. IoT equipment and detectors are used to monitor various aspects of agricultural operations, including soil moisture, temperature, nutrient levels, and weather conditions. By collecting and analyzing this data, farmers can make informed decisions approximately when and how to water crops, apply plant food, and make other adjustments to optimize crop yields. Cloud computing enables farmers to reserve and process massive quantities of information, which is crucial in agriculture where data can originate from different sources, such as sensors, and IoT devices. Smart farming is an information-informed agricultural strategy that employs information technologies to maximize the efficiency, productivity and sustainability of agricultural processes. This paper exhibits a survey of the contemporary advances in IoT in Agriculture Applications. Furthermore, the paper outlines the strengths and weaknesses of each methods and issues that remain to be resolved in the area. The primary findings of the study show that from 100 articles. IoT, Cloud Computing, Smart Farming, Blockchain, Precision Agriculture, Machine Learning, and Wireless Sensor Networks are the topics reviewed for the survey.
